Output 078de638d2efb4e22e8b58bfc5f383d3e39e7d32a993fa7346ec35f83a6745aa:1

value
150700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3ba6f6b832a4586e685193d08dc93dbd2a9597 OP_EQUAL
address
3PE6rXJy8EzGMe88vLxk3ej3cy3ujEehzY
transaction
078de638d2efb4e22e8b58bfc5f383d3e39e7d32a993fa7346ec35f83a6745aa
spent
true